Job Description

Be part of the dynamic and innovative Science Operations team where we are part of a broader mission to Lead Walt Disney Parks and Resorts, Care for animals and the environment, Connect people to nature, and Conserve our natural resources. As the Science Fellow – Animal Physiology Project Hire, you will assist the Science Operations team at Disney’s Animal Kingdom® and Disney’s Animal Kingdom Lodge® with operational and strategic projects related to animal physiology and welfare. You will collaborate with partners within the Science Operations team and Animal Husbandry teams to complete these science-based projects. This one-year project hire role, with option to renew for an additional year, will report to the Animal Welfare Science Manager. Responsibilities include assisting in the design, implementation, and completion of scientific projects focused on understanding animal physiology in the context of applied animal care and wellbeing. Project assignments may include expanding techniques for assessing hormonal and reproductive status in various species (e.g., elephants, rhinos), facilitating collaborative projects on the physiology of understudied species (e.g., manatees) using a variety of animal sample types, developing novel methods and tools to assess animal physiology (e.g., chemiluminescence immunoassay, liquid chromatography), advancing departmental biobanking initiatives for scientific, conservation, and clinical applications. Support ongoing operational projects such as measuring hormones in various exotic animal species to assess physiology including pregnancy, effective contraception, and positive well-being as part of a comprehensive wellness program; analyzing data and presenting animal hormone and behavior information to science and animal husbandry and health partners to aid animal management decisions; maintaining Disney’s standard operating guidelines for lab safety and providing daily technical support for maintenance of assays and equipment in the Disney Science Center Lab. Contribute to building scientific capacity for Animals, Science and Environment Cast, share team projects and stories with Disney Guests, develop interactive and interpretive science experiences for Disney Guests, and communicate project findings in partner/team meetings and scientific/popular publications. Required qualifications include a minimum of one year of non-classroom research laboratory experience in an established scientific research program, excellent written and oral communication and interpersonal skills for audiences of all ages, ability to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ented atmosphere and in view of the public, and enthusiasm for animal conservation and care in zoos. Preferred qualifications include demonstrated experience with enzyme immunoassays or chemiluminescence immunoassays, HPLC, and associated data analysis; advanced understanding of applied organic and inorganic chemistry; and experience working in zoos/aquariums. Required education is an M.S. in biology, physiology, animal science, endocrinology, biochemistry, or related field.
